Description
This is a true food-focused cycling tour in Évora, combining relaxed bike riding with tastings of the region’s most iconic flavours. As a UNESCO World Heritage Site, Évora blends history, culture, and gastronomy in a compact, bike-friendly setting that invites you to explore and indulge.
We stop at small traditional shops, local grocery stores with organic products, and pastry shops famous for their conventual sweets. Along the way you can taste and buy regional wine, olive oil, jams, honey and chocolates. The diversity and intensity of flavours will surprise you.
Temptation is the keyword of the day, and the cycling helps balance out those extra calories.
Between tastings, we take you inside Évora’s must-see landmarks, including the cathedral, the university and the iconic Bones Chapel.
The tour is suitable for children who are able to ride a bike. We provide bikes for kids and child seats when needed. For families with younger children, a private tour is recommended and available for an additional cost.
